The Orbit Fox: Duplicate Page, Menu Icons, SVG Support, Cookie Notice, Custom Fonts & More WordPress plugin before 3.0.8 does not sanitize uploaded SVG files when its SVG upload feature is enabled, allowing authenticated users with the upload capability (Author and above by default, without the unfiltered_html capability) to upload SVG files containing JavaScript that executes in the site context when the file is viewed, leading to Stored Cross-Site Scripting.
